Merlin Cyber is a cybersecurity and identity management company focused on serving government agencies. It offers identity and access management solutions designed to reduce the time, complexity, and cost of meeting Executive Order (EO) compliance requirements. Its capabilities include self-funded modernization, cryptographic asset discovery, and protection to enable crypto-agility and accelerate FedRAMP compliance. The company positions itself as a leading provider of modern cybersecurity solutions tailored to all levels of government.
